Steve Yzerman feels pressure for next season with the Detroit Red Wings
Photo credit: The Hockey News

Detroit Red Wings GM Steve Yzerman has admitted to feeling the pressure as the team aims to meet rising fan expectations.

Despite coming close to making the playoffs last year with 91 points and 41 wins, Yzerman knows that being close is not enough. The Red Wings have not made the playoffs since the 2016-17 season, and the near-miss has only put up the expectations without the satisfaction of playoff hockey.
Yzerman remains committed to his long-term plan to rebuild the Red Wings into a dominant NHL team, similar to the powerhouse they were during his playing days. He emphasizes that short-term pressures will not change his approach, refusing to call it the "Yzer-plan." Instead, he focuses on maintaining the course he believes is right for the team's future, even if it takes years to achieve the desired success.
"We're probably going to have to get more than 91 points next year to get in. That'll be a challenge for us," Yzerman acknowledged.

Despite the pressure, he remains focused on his strategy, understanding the importance of patience and perseverance in building a championship-caliber team.
